Ingredients

Dry Ingredients:
- 1 cup all-purpose flour
- 3/4 cup whole wheat flour
- 1 teaspoon baking soda
- 1/2 teaspoon baking powder
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
- 1/4 teaspoon ground nutmeg
Wet Ingredients:
- 1/3 cup melted coconut oil (or vegetable oil)
- 1/2 cup honey or maple syrup
- 2 large eggs
- 1/2 cup plain Greek yogurt
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1 1/2 cups grated zucchini (about 1 medium)
- 1/2 cup chopped walnuts or pecans (optional)
- 1/4 cup raisins or mini chocolate chips (optional)
Instructions
- Preheat the oven: Preheat the oven to 350°F and prepare a muffin tin.
- Mix dry ingredients: In a bowl, whisk together flours, baking soda, baking powder, salt, cinnamon, and nutmeg.
- Combine wet ingredients: In a separate bowl, mix oil, sweetener, eggs, yogurt, and vanilla. Stir in zucchini.
- Combine wet and dry: Add dry ingredients to wet mixture, fold in nuts or raisins, and mix until just combined.
- Bake: Divide batter into muffin cups and bake for 18–22 minutes.
- Cool and enjoy: Let muffins cool before serving.
Notes
- These muffins freeze well and are perfect for meal prep.
- For dairy-free option, use plant-based yogurt and dairy-free chocolate chips.
- Add oats or turbinado sugar on top before baking for extra texture.
